CHINA’S NEWLY APPOINTED ENVOY HOLDS LUNCHEON WITH FIRST LADY LIZA MARCOS

China’s new ambassador to the Philippines, Jing Quan, attended a luncheon hosted by First Lady Liza Araneta-Marcos at the Laperal Mansion on Dec. 17.

The event, held just weeks after Quan’s arrival, included other diplomats from the Chinese Embassy, such as Chargé d’Affaires Zhou Zhiyong.

During the gathering, attendees had lunch, enjoyed wine, and toured the mansion.

The Chinese embassy expressed gratitude for the First Lady’s hospitality, while Marcos highlighted their partnership in Chinatown’s revitalization, culture, and heritage.

Quan succeeded former ambassador Huang Xilian and assumed his post in early December.
